Output 3214689ac86f184a361399ad735186e9bd3fb2d7e95a0b36cd024e1594fc7d57:71

value
70060
script pubkey
OP_0 OP_PUSHBYTES_20 c2949c95d66db71684b059797512e7ee7a51267c
address
bc1qc22fe9wkdkm3dp9st9uh2yh8aea9zfnu0qtr3m
transaction
3214689ac86f184a361399ad735186e9bd3fb2d7e95a0b36cd024e1594fc7d57
confirmations
13228
spent
true